Overview

New York Institute of Technology's six schools and colleges offer undergraduate, graduate, doctoral, and professional degree programs in in-demand disciplines including computer science, data science, and cybersecurity; biology, health professions, and medicine; architecture and design; engineering; IT and digital technologies; management; and energy and sustainability. A nonprofit, independent, private, and nonsectarian institute of higher education founded in 1955, it welcomes nearly 8,000 students worldwide.

 

The university has campuses in New York City and Long Island, New York; Jonesboro, Arkansas; and Vancouver, British Columbia, as well as programs around the world. More than 120,000 alumni are part of an engaged network of physicians, architects, scientists, engineers, business leaders, digital artists, and healthcare professionals. Together, the university’s community of doers, makers, healers, and innovators empowers graduates to change the world, solve 21st-century challenges, and reinvent the future.

NYTech’s College of Osteopathic Medicine seeks an Administrative Specialist for the department of Osteopathic and Manipulative Medicine (OMM) located at the Long island (Old Westbury, NY) campus.

Responsibilities

  • Provide administrative support to the faculty and the Department of Osteopathic Manipulative Medicine (OMM) to ensure efficient daily operations and support of departmental, academic, clinical, and event-related activities.
  • Assist faculty with departmental and school-related needs, including ordering supplies, scrubs, and equipment, and supporting faculty requests related to technology, logistics, and general administrative operations.
  • Track faculty attendance and manage vacation and absence requests. Coordinate and submit clinic block schedules and assist with faculty scheduling needs.
  • Facilitate and support work-study students and the OMM Teaching Assistant (TA) program, including scheduling, communication, and administrative coordination.
  • Maintain and manage the department’s teaching, clinic, and event calendars, including scheduling and reservations for the OMM laboratory and other campus spaces.Manage calendar and schedules, ensuring efficient coordination of meetings, appointments, and events while maintaining strong organization and attention to detail.
  • Process, monitor, and track departmental expenditures, faculty reimbursements, purchasing requests, and event-related expenses. Assist with budget oversight and financial administrative processes, including Workday transactions, purchasing workflows, and expense tracking.
  • Budget management.
  • Assist with planning and coordinating departmental meetings, continuing medical education (CME) events, and OMM Center programming, including identifying appropriate event space, managing registration, ordering catering, requesting ATG and facilities support, and coordinating logistics for successful event execution.
  • Support promotional and communication efforts for departmental and OMM Center events, including advertising, announcements, and outreach to faculty, staff, students, and external participants.
  • Assist with coordinating and scheduling student organization activities (including SAAO events), as well as scheduling student rotations with OMM department faculty.
  • Serve as a primary departmental liaison for students, faculty, research subjects, and external inquiries, providing professional, timely, and responsive communication.
  • Maintain accurate records, support departmental reporting needs, and ensure administrative processes are handled in a timely and organized manner.
  • Other duties as assigned to support the department and college as needs arise.

Qualifications

  • A Bachelor of Arts degree is required.
  • Familiarity with budget management and Workday systems is highly prefered.
  • Proficiency in MS office, Adobe Suites, Zoom, Microsoft Teams.
  • Strong organizational skills with the ability to multi-task.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
  • Attention to detail and problem solving skills.
  • Excellent time management skills and the ability to prioritize work
